The Problem

London claims to be one of the most ‘accessible’ cities in Europe.  But where do disabled people stay in our capital city?  And what does ‘accessible’ truly mean?

Most people think ‘accessible accommodation’ is a wider door and some grab rails, presuming that ‘one size fits all’.  There are over 165,000 hotel rooms in London for able-bodied guests.  Disabled people with complex physical needs currently have ZERO.  Is it fair that they should the miss out?  Here lies the problem.

FACT:  The reality is there are approximately 250,000 + people in the UK with complex physical disability and nowhere for them (or their families, so over 1 million people) to stay in London.  Not a single hotel room nor self-catering option.  Let that sink in for a moment.

 These individuals simply cannot safely stay without:

  • Level wheelchair access
  • Profiling bed
  • Ceiling hoist for transfer
  • Fully accessible bathroom
  • Adjoining room for their caregiver

What are we spending the money on?

Internal remodelling

Removing walls to create an open plan living space.  This will provide space for wheelchair users to easily circulate and allow the family/group to be inclusive.

Building an accessible bathroom extension and fitting it out

This is our son’s fully accessible bathroom at home, showing plenty of space for his wheelchair and carers, ceiling hoist for transfers, height adjustable bath, changing table and accessible basin and a wash/dry toilet.  

 1627057960_f692e31b-a4f9-4a62-acd2-aaf4b005e7fb.jpeg

 This is the exceptional standard we wish to replicate at AbleStay.

We will be providing other essentials like a medical fridge, plenty of plug sockets for monitors/suction machines, IV stand for feeds, kitchen blender for those who are tube fed.  From experience, these small items really will take stress away.

If the demand for accessible accommodation is so great, why hasn’t it been done before?

A lack of understanding.  Unless you have a disability or understand disability from a lived experience (as we have with our son), it is off your radar.

It is too difficult for hotels to address.  A wide door and grab rails tick their accessibility box, so why provide more?  AbleStay wants to make a key difference in raising awareness of the needs for disabled people, inspiring hotels and companies to change their blinkered approach.

It is too expensive for self-catering holiday home owners to contemplate (and they are unlikely to have the knowledge).

This situation has to be addressed and we feel it is our duty to take on this role.  We have the experience, knowledge, understanding and most importantly, the absolute passion to make a change.
